- nginx服务器可以打开的文件数量受操作系统的限制,教程
- 编辑 /etc/sysctl.conf,键入:
vi /etc/sysctl.conf
- 追加或者修改下面的行
fs.file-max = 70000
- 保存并关闭文件,编辑 /etc/securlty/limits.conf,键入:
vi /etc/securlty/limits.conf
- 像下面这样为用户或者nginx用户设置软硬限制
nginx soft nofile 10000 nginx hard nofile 30000
- 保存并关闭,最后重新载入 sysctl命令,以使以上改变生效:
sysctl -p
- nginx worker_rlimit_nofile Option (在nginx级别上提高打开的文件句柄限制)
- nginx也有同样的限制,可以通过worker_rlimit_nofile来增加此限制数量。来设置被nginx进程最大文件打开的数量,编辑nginx.conf,键入:
vi /usr/local/nginx/conf/nginx.conf (视你的配置文件的位置而定)
- 追加或者编辑:
worker_rlimit_nofile 30000;
- 保存并关闭文件,重新加载nginx配置,并重新执行开始查看软硬限制的命令
网友评论